π
<-
Chat plein-écran
[^]

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-CG50

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ude critor » 17 Mai 2023, 09:54

Pardon, petite question, je n'ai pas de quoi tester sous la main.

Je suppose que vous n'avez pas corrigé le non clignotement de la diode lorsque l'on active le mode examen Upsilon sur Casio ?
Image
Avatar de l’utilisateur
critorAdmin
Niveau 19: CU (Créateur Universel)
Niveau 19: CU (Créateur Universel)
Prochain niv.: 42.7%
 
Messages: 41502
Images: 14751
Inscription: 25 Oct 2008, 00:00
Localisation: Montpellier
Genre: Homme
Calculatrice(s):
MyCalcs profile
YouTube: critor3000
Twitter/X: critor2000
GitHub: critor

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ude parisse » 17 Mai 2023, 10:19

Hélas, j'en suis bien incapable!
Bon en réalité c'est une question délicate. Supposons que je cherche et que je finisse par trouver, quelle serait la réaction de Casio? Il me semble qu'il y a plus de risques de voir un virage sécuritaire à la TI ou à la Numworks que d'une collaboration où certains addins touchant au mode examen seraient tolérés (en tout cas c'est comme cela que j'interprète le fait que malgré mes demandes répétées, Casio n'a jamais rien fait pour autoriser KhiCAS en mode examen sur les Graph 90).
Or j'ai l'impression que le mode examen n'est pas appliqué dans beaucoup de pays, ce qui explique probablement que KhiCAS est de plus en plus utilisé sur les fxcg50, l'addin en langue anglaise a beaucoup plus de succès qu'en langue française. Par exemple, depuis le début 2023, la doc en anglais a été consultée 6583 fois, la doc en français 1420 fois, l'addin en anglais a été téléchargé 1720 fois, l'addin en français 352 fois. C'est dommage pour la France, mais je n'ai aucun poids face aux décideurs (nul n'est prophète en son pays), il faudrait sans doute une mobilisation importante des profs de maths pour faire changer les choses, et encore pas sur que ça suffise.
Il me semble donc qu'il vaut mieux ne pas essayer de chercher, en tout cas pour l'instant.

Pour en revenir aux améliorations de ma version d'Upsilon: il y a
  • sauvegardes et restauration de backups de l'état de la calculatrice (ce qui est stocké dans le scriptstore, ça ne contient hélas pas l'historique des calculs, il faudrait faire des modifs dans Upsilon pour ça)
  • le tas Python passe de 69500 octets à 3014656 (2.9M)
  • import permet d'ouvrir un script Python depuis la flash Casio (pas besoin de le recopier dans le scriptstore Numworks), on a donc accès à 16M de flash contre 64K de scriptstore.
  • depuis le home d'Upsilon, on peut échanger des fichiers vers la flash Casio (VARS)
Avatar de l’utilisateur
parisseVIP++
Niveau 12: CP (Calculatrice sur Pattes)
Niveau 12: CP (Calculatrice sur Pattes)
Prochain niv.: 78%
 
Messages: 3511
Inscription: 13 Déc 2013, 16:35
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ude DoOmnimaga » 17 Mai 2023, 12:34

De combien est le tas Python sur fx-CG10 et CG20? Si j'ai pu comprendre le comparateur de calculatrices les fx-CG10 et 20 ont 4 fois moins de RAM totale que la fx-CG50 et Graph 90+E, soit 2 Mo au lieu de 8.
Image Image Image Now active at https://discord.gg/cuZcfcF (CodeWalrus server)
Avatar de l’utilisateur
DoOmnimagaPremium
Niveau 12: CP (Calculatrice sur Pattes)
Niveau 12: CP (Calculatrice sur Pattes)
Prochain niv.: 8.1%
 
Messages: 683
Images: 25
Inscription: 21 Fév 2012, 12:04
Localisation: Quebec, Canada
Genre: Homme
Calculatrice(s):
MyCalcs profile
Classe: 11eme annee scolaire termine
YouTube: DJOmnimaga
Twitter/X: DJOmnimaga
Facebook: djomnimaga

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ude parisse » 17 Mai 2023, 13:03

DJ Omnimaga a écrit:De combien est le tas Python sur fx-CG10 et CG20? Si j'ai pu comprendre le comparateur de calculatrices les fx-CG10 et 20 ont 4 fois moins de RAM totale que la fx-CG50 et Graph 90+E, soit 2 Mo au lieu de 8.

Il est actuellement comme sur une vraie Numworks avec Upsilon, donc 69500 octets. On peut certainement faire mieux, mais il faut du code adapté. Par exemple il reste de la place dans la zone ram+stack, je dirais de l'ordre de 200K, à vérifier.
Avatar de l’utilisateur
parisseVIP++
Niveau 12: CP (Calculatrice sur Pattes)
Niveau 12: CP (Calculatrice sur Pattes)
Prochain niv.: 78%
 
Messages: 3511
Inscription: 13 Déc 2013, 16:35
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ude parisse » 17 Mai 2023, 15:36

Voilà, j'ai mis à jour, sur les Prizm on devrait avoir 192K de tas Python.
Avatar de l’utilisateur
parisseVIP++
Niveau 12: CP (Calculatrice sur Pattes)
Niveau 12: CP (Calculatrice sur Pattes)
Prochain niv.: 78%
 
Messages: 3511
Inscription: 13 Déc 2013, 16:35
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ude ggauny@live.fr » 17 Mai 2023, 17:57

Ce n'est sûrement pas un problème, mais sur la dernière Màj, les icônes Python et RPN ont écahangé leurs place sur l'écran Upsilon.
Avatar de l’utilisateur
ggauny@live.frPremium
Niveau 9: IC (Compteur Infatigable)
Niveau 9: IC (Compteur Infatigable)
Prochain niv.: 43.4%
 
Messages: 283
Inscription: 11 Mar 2015, 20:43
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ude ggauny@live.fr » 19 Mai 2023, 10:10

Bonjour à tous,
Peut-on "télécharger" (avec le cable USB) sur la Graph90+e, lorsque l'on est sous Upsilon, des programmes depuis Numworks ou depuis des sources telles que NSI, ou doit-on écrire ces programmes "à la main" dans Python/Upsilon ?

Je ne parviens pas à "télécharger" avec le cable.
Merci.
Avatar de l’utilisateur
ggauny@live.frPremium
Niveau 9: IC (Compteur Infatigable)
Niveau 9: IC (Compteur Infatigable)
Prochain niv.: 43.4%
 
Messages: 283
Inscription: 11 Mar 2015, 20:43
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ude parisse » 19 Mai 2023, 11:55

il n'y a pas d'USB dans Upsilon. Pour utiliser des scripts existants, copiez-les sur la Graph 90 connectée comme clef USB au PC. Vous pouvez ensuite transférer ces scripts de l'espace de stockage Casio vers les enregistrements d'Upsilon en tapant VARS depuis le home d'Upsilon. Vous pouvez aussi importer directement un script Python Casio avec la commande import depuis Upsilon, sans avoir besoin de le transférer.
Vous devriez aussi pouvoir faire un backup de votre Numworks depuis https://www-fourier.univ-grenoble-alpes.fr/~parisse/nws.html puis le mettre sur la Casio, puis l'importer dans Upsilon depuis le home de Upsilon touche VARS (attention, je n'ai pas encore testé).
Avatar de l’utilisateur
parisseVIP++
Niveau 12: CP (Calculatrice sur Pattes)
Niveau 12: CP (Calculatrice sur Pattes)
Prochain niv.: 78%
 
Messages: 3511
Inscription: 13 Déc 2013, 16:35
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ude ggauny@live.fr » 19 Mai 2023, 14:40

Merci ! Absolument génial !!!
Avatar de l’utilisateur
ggauny@live.frPremium
Niveau 9: IC (Compteur Infatigable)
Niveau 9: IC (Compteur Infatigable)
Prochain niv.: 43.4%
 
Messages: 283
Inscription: 11 Mar 2015, 20:43
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

Re: Firmware NumWorks-Upsilon porté sur Casio Graph 90+E fx-

Message non lude parisse » 20 Mai 2023, 08:57

Nouvelle mise à jour avec quelques corrections:
https://www-fourier.univ-grenoble-alpes.fr/~parisse/casio/upsilon.g3a
Attention, il faut effacer nwstore.nws si vous aviez installé une version précédente, sinon il y aura un crash s'il y a des sauvegardes de fonctions par exemple (si vous voulez comprendre pourquoi, lisez ce qui suit).

Il existe maintenant une version pour TI Nspire CX et CX2
https://www-fourier.univ-grenoble-alpes.fr/~parisse/ti/upsilon.tns
Les changements par rapport au source de Upsilon sont ici
https://www-fourier.univ-grenoble-alpes.fr/~parisse/ti/upsilon_changes.tgz
La version TI est un peu moins complète que la version Casio, seuls les scripts Python sont sauvegardés quand on quitte et qu'on relance. En effet, le choix qui a été fait par Numworks dans Epsilon de sauvegarder les expressions en écrivant les pointeurs adresses vers les noeuds des fonctions de Poincaré (comme sin/cos/etc.) rend toute sauvegarde d'expression inutilisable dès que ces adresse changent dans le programme ou firmware. Sur Casio, un addin sera toujours chargé en mémoire à la même adresse, ce qui permet de sauvegarder des expressions (à condition que l'addin n'ait pas été mis à jour). Sur TI Nspire, ce n'est pas le cas. Sur une "vraie" Numworks, cela rend incompatible un backup d'une version de firmware à un autre et c'est certainement pour cela qu'il n'y a pas de sauvegarde lors d'une mise à jour. On pourrait par contre sauvegarder les scripts Python uniquement comme je le fais sur la TI Nspire.
Pour le moment, ON/OFF n'est pas supporté sur les TI Nspire ni le réglage du contraste (mais c'est faisable), et les répertoires ne sont pas non plus supportés pour les échanges de scripts Python entre Upsilon et le système de fichiers de la calculatrice hote.
Avatar de l’utilisateur
parisseVIP++
Niveau 12: CP (Calculatrice sur Pattes)
Niveau 12: CP (Calculatrice sur Pattes)
Prochain niv.: 78%
 
Messages: 3511
Inscription: 13 Déc 2013, 16:35
Genre: Non spécifié
Calculatrice(s):
MyCalcs profile

PrécédenteSuivante

Retourner vers News Casio

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 116 invités

-
Rechercher
-
Social TI-Planet
-
Sujets à la une
Comparaisons des meilleurs prix pour acheter sa calculatrice !
Aidez la communauté à documenter les révisions matérielles en listant vos calculatrices graphiques !
Phi NumWorks jailbreak
123
-
Faire un don / Premium
Pour plus de concours, de lots, de tests, nous aider à payer le serveur et les domaines...
Faire un don
Découvrez les avantages d'un compte donateur !
JoinRejoignez the donors and/or premium!les donateurs et/ou premium !


Partenaires et pub
Notre partenaire Jarrety Calculatrices à acheter chez Calcuso
-
Stats.
1828 utilisateurs:
>1810 invités
>13 membres
>5 robots
Record simultané (sur 6 mois):
6892 utilisateurs (le 07/06/2017)
-
Autres sites intéressants
Texas Instruments Education
Global | France
 (English / Français)
Banque de programmes TI
ticalc.org
 (English)
La communauté TI-82
tout82.free.fr
 (Français)